Chile Rellenos Pie

"Chile Rellenos without all the mess, but all the flavor. Good for company! Excellent for a buffet table! Variations include adding small chopped cooked shrimp or chopped cooked crab to the filling for an excellent brunch dish. Monterey jack cheese may be used instead of Mexican-style cheese."
PREP TIME  15 Min
COOK TIME  45 Min
READY IN  1 Hr
Original recipe yield 9 inch pie

INGREDIENTS (Nutrition)

  • 4 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ro
  • 1 red bell pepper, diced
  • 1 pinch salt
  • 1 pinch ground black pepper
  • 2 dashes jalapeno sauce
  • 1 cup shredded Cheddar-Monterey Jack cheese blend
  • 1 (4 ounce) can diced green chiles
  • 1 tomatillo, diced
  • 1 recipe pastry for a 9 inch single crust pie

DIRECTIONS

  1. Beat the eggs. Combine with milk, cilantro, bell pepper, spices, cheese, chiles, and tomatillo. Pour filling into the pie shell.
  2. Bake at 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) for 45 to 50 minutes, or until knife inserted in center comes out clean. Cool to room temperature. Garnish each individual piece of pie with a dollop of sour cream and drizzle with your favorite salsa!
